oracle数据库报错密码过期
问题场景
1、Oracle如果避免密码过期?
2、登录金蝶云星空提示ORA-28001错误。
解决方案
1、在Oracle服务器上进入sqlplus。
参考命令:sqlplus / as sysdba;
2、执行SQL查看用户密码的有效期设置(一般默认的配置文件是DEFAULT)
SELECT * FROM dba_profiles WHERE profile='DEFAULT' AND resource_name='PASSWORD_LIFE_TIME';
3、如上图有效期为默认的180天。以下脚本将密码有效期修改成“无限制”。修改之后立即生效(但已经过期的密码需要重设一次密码)。
ALTER PROFILE DEFAULT LIMIT PASSWORD_LIFE_TIME UNLIMITED;
4、已经触发有效期限制的用户需参考以下SQL给用户重设一次密码以便更新有效期。
4-1、如果希望密码不变可以使用原密码作为脚本里的密码执行。
4-2、SQL语句的用户名、密码需要替换为实际值。
ALTER USER 用户名 IDENTIFIED BY 密码;
5、使用修改后的用户登录,如果报“ORA-28000:用户已被锁”,可使用以下SQL解锁(注意替换用户名为实际值)。
ALTER USER 用户名 ACCOUNT UNLOCK;
6、如果更新了密码,金蝶云星空服务端需要参考修改数据库密码,数据中心未加载 解决方案处理。
oracle数据库报错密码过期
问题场景1、Oracle如果避免密码过期?2、登录金蝶云星空提示ORA-28001错误。解决方案1、在Oracle服务器上进入sqlplus。 参考命令:sqlplus...
点击下载文档
本文2024-09-23 01:16:37发表“云星空知识”栏目。
本文链接:https://wenku.my7c.com/article/kingdee-k3cloud-144915.html
您需要登录后才可以发表评论, 登录登录 或者 注册
最新文档
热门文章